Transaction 98fcbee2c73c6843bf092757503415908fa1590e57280074f79ef7e005decd71
1 Input
2 Outputs
- 98fcbee2c73c6843bf092757503415908fa1590e57280074f79ef7e005decd71:0
- 98fcbee2c73c6843bf092757503415908fa1590e57280074f79ef7e005decd71:1
value 888812
address 15wj7tuPmR7r28QE5riNXkG1CWGUQYY6Qr
value 4681665
address 13i6JYcRQ6FrPEZUGE2qPZwjbZJ6DNaEcZ